In 2021, we witness the clash of the titans: the pinnacle of a franchise that began to take shape eight years ago. But the Monsterverse stories are far from over. In March 2022, Warner Bros. Pictures confirmed their plans to start filming on a sequel, again with Adam Wingard in the directing chair. And now we have new details about Godzilla vs Kong 2 which will bear the official title Godzilla x Kong: The New Empire. With this, another unlikely alliance arises between our favorite colossi, in the face of a new threat.

In the 2021 film, the gigantic primate and the king of kaijus they had to iron out rough edges and fight side by side due to the irruption of the ferocious Mechagodzilla. But, is there really a greater danger than that killing machine devised by fear and human ambition? We’ll find out in the future sequel to Godzilla x Kongwhose official synopsis dictates the following (via Collider):
“This latest entry continues the explosive fight of Godzilla vs. Kong with an all-new cinematic adventure, pitting the almighty Kong and the fearsome Godzilla against a colossal unknown threat that lurks within our world, challenging its very existence and ours. The epic new film will delve into the stories of these titans, their origins, and the mysteries of Skull Island and beyond, as they uncover the mythical battle that helped forge these extraordinary beings and bound them to humanity forever.”

In addition to the return of Adam Wingard as director, the sequel will once again feature Rebecca Hall (Ilene Andrews), Brian Tyree Henry (Bernie Hayes) and Kaylee Hottle (Jia) in the cast. On the other hand, the actors that will soon be added to the Monsterverse of Legendary Pictures include Dan Stevens, Rachel House, Alex Ferns and Fala Chen.
When it premieres?
Godzilla x Kong: The New Empire will arrive April 11, 2024 to theaters in Latin America.
